In 1912, over 2,000 years of imperial rule ended as the last emperor of the Qing dynasty abdicated and the Republic of China was born. Some are well known outside of China, like Hong Kong and Beijing, while others are not. … how does faith come by hearingWebThe China–Pakistan border is 596 kilometres (370 mi) and runs west–east from the tripoint with Afghanistan to the disputed tripoint with India in the vicinity of the Siachen Glacier. It traverses the Karakoram Mountains, one of the world's tallest mountain ranges. The Yangtze and the Yellow Rivers are the most important. At 3,915 miles (6,300 kilometers) long, the Yangtze is the world's third largest river.
